WebIf the taxpayer (partner, S corporation shareholder or sole-proprietor) has taxable income below $157,500 on a single return or $315,000 on a married filing jointly return, the exclusion for specified service businesses does not apply nor do the W-2 wage limitation or unadjusted basis limitation. WebThe accrual method is required if the entity fails both the $1 million average revenue and the material income-producing factor tests. For C corporations: The cash method is allowed if the company is a qualified personal service corporation. The cash method is always allowed if the corporation meets the $1 million average revenue test.
